Pros: Solid, very reliable, a looker, stunning colours and sharpness
Cons: Price
Since purchasing the 1D in June 2007, have shot rigorously in many situations and never been let down. This is a testament to the durability of a Canon 1 series camera, which has now progressed further ahead with the latest Digic III technology.
There's very little to fault on the camera, apart from the widespread reported focusing issues, which fortunately I've never encountered. (Still using non blue dot upgrade, and latest 1.2.3 firmware).
The best points:
* 10 fps, never miss a shot
* ISO 6400 - very usable
* Output sharpness
* Output colour
* Live view - has come in handy on several occasions, and fine tuning focus at 10x view
* Weather sealing/durability (shot in rain/sleet/snow/hail/extreme humid conditions, and never faltered.
